Product Overview

Microsoft Project
Microsoft Project

Description: Microsoft Project is a project management software application developed by Microsoft. It enables users to manage projects by tracking tasks, resources, budgets and timelines. The tool is designed for professional project managers across industries.

WorkflowMax
WorkflowMax

Description: WorkflowMax is a comprehensive job management software designed for small and medium businesses. It allows creating estimates and quotes, scheduling jobs, tracking time and expenses, invoicing clients, and managing inventory and purchasing workflows.
